PRODUCT INTRODUCTION
description
Amrinone is a 3,4'-bipyridine substituted at positions 5 and 6 by an amino group and a keto function respectively. A pyridine phosphodiesterase 3 inhibitor, it is a drug that may improve the prognosis in patients with congestive heart failure. It has a role as an EC 3.1.4.* (phosphoric diester hydrolase) inhibitor.
